Issue descriptionUserAgent: Mozilla/5.0 (Windows NT 6.1; WOW64) AppleWebKit/537.36 (KHTML, like Gecko) Chrome/57.0.2987.133 Safari/537.36 Steps to reproduce the problem: 1. Go to site using Vbulletin 2. Click Edit, then "Advanced Edit" 3. ERR_BLOCKED_BY_XSS_AUDITOR error appears What is the expected behavior? I should be able to edit my post What went wrong? Normal links are triggering these error messages. If I remove these links from my post using the "Quick Edit" feature, I can then click "advanced edit" without the error. If the links remains, I get the error. These are just normal forum links and should not trigger a security alert. Example: https://www.epicnpc.com/threads/1019842-Account-Store-Lv-Ar-8-Legend-CN-LD-from-5-Updated (a normal post on our site) the URL code is the trigger, if I remove the link code, and just leave plain text, it does not trigger the error. https://www.epicnpc.com/itrader.php?u=474815 (our feedback system) itrader.php is the trigger Did this work before?
